The triumph of the first Home Alone movie marked the end of Hughess great run, one that included three National Lampoons Vacation films starring Chevy Chase and Beverly DAngelo, the teen movies, and Planes, Trains, and Automobiles. Theres an undeniable urgency and energy to the movies from the 1980s that bear his name that you just dont find in his later work. They grew more polished, but missed the originality and distinct appeal of his earlier works. The mansion, which is on Woodland Road, won an award from the Lake Forest Preservation Foundation in 2007 as a new-construction in-fill development. The six-bedroom Lake Forest estate of the late Nancy Hughes, the wife of filmmaker John Hughes, sold Aug. 10, 2020, for $2.9 million. Hughes died Sept. 15, one day after she was honored for her latest charitable gesture to the Lake Forest community being the largest private contributor to a roughly $2 million public-private project to repair North Beach Access Road in Lake Forest. Mrs. Hughes had taken her mom into her Lake Forest home and been a devoted caregiver, her son said, despite the grief that followed the deaths of her sister Janice in 2000, her father Hank in 2013, and her husband in 2009. Over the following decade, Hughes went on to write and produce critical duds like the 1993 adaptation of Dennis the Menace, 1994s Babys Day Out, and a quirky but forgettable remake of The Absent-Minded Professor starring Robin Williams, 1997s Flubber.
